Assignment Editor Jobs in Ashland, VA

An Assignment Editor in the broadcasting industry serves as the primary point of contact for news, stories, and events that the news station covers. They are tasked with deciding what stories are of interest to the audience, assigning reporters and photographers to cover those stories, and ensuring that all assignments are completed on time. They also manage the logistical aspects such as coordinating with other departments, making travel arrangements, and handling other administrative duties. They play a vital role in the newsroom, often juggling multiple tasks at once and making quick decisions under pressure.

Strong communication skills, excellent judgment, multitasking ability, and the capacity to work under intense pressure are critical skills for an Assignment Editor. A degree in journalism, communications, or a related field is often required. Additionally, knowledge of news production software and social media platforms is beneficial. Prior to becoming an Assignment Editor, a person may have roles such as a News Reporter, News Producer, or News Photographer. These roles offer the necessary experience in a newsroom environment and provide a solid understanding of what makes a story newsworthy, both of which are essential for an Assignment Editor.
